Understanding the Beast: What are Staking Derivatives?

Before we dive into the risks, let’s define our playing field. Staking derivatives represent a claim on the future yield generated by staking underlying crypto assets. They offer increased liquidity and flexibility compared to traditional staking. Sounds fantastic, right? But remember, this added flexibility comes at a price.

Smart Contract Risk: The Code That Can Break

Smart contracts are the backbone of staking derivatives. But they are only as strong as the code they’re built on. Bugs, exploits, vulnerabilities…they all exist. A single flaw can be catastrophic. Remember the DAO hack? Millions vanished. Poof. Gone. That’s the power – and the danger – of smart contracts.

  • Audits are crucial. Look for projects that have undergone rigorous, independent security audits. Multiple audits are even better.
  • Transparency is key. Is the code open source? Can you examine it yourself or have an expert review it? If not, red flag.

Impermanent Loss: The Hidden Tax

This one’s sneaky. Impermanent loss can erode your profits, even when the market is seemingly doing well. It arises from the price fluctuations between the paired assets in a liquidity pool. Don’t get caught off guard. Understand the mechanics of impermanent loss and factor it into your risk assessment.

Centralization Risk: The Illusion of Decentralization

Some staking derivative platforms boast decentralization, but peel back the layers and you might find a surprising level of control concentrated in a few hands. This can create vulnerabilities. Who controls the upgrade process? Who holds the admin keys? These are critical questions to ask. True decentralization is a spectrum, not a binary. Don’t be fooled by marketing hype.
